Developer guide
- Getting started with Finesse development
- Guide to the Finesse source code
- Finesse internal code structure
- Developer tools
- Packaging Finesse
- Releasing finesse
- Contributing to the documentation
- How to add a notebook to the documentation
- Before starting, some info
- Step 0: Discuss your plan
- Step 1. Write your notebook
- Step 2. Create your git branch from an up-to-date development branch
- Step 3. Add your notebook to the documentation
- Step 4. Create a merge request
- Step 5. Your merge request is reviewed
- Step 6. Your page is accepted and merged
- Annexe: Quick MyST reference
- Contributing to the editor extensions
- Finesse code style
- Testing
- Todo List
- Continuous integration
- Debugging Finesse